How much does it cost to rent an apartment in McCallsburg?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| McCallsburg Studio Apartments | $855 | $610 | $965 |
| McCallsburg 1 Bedroom Apartments | $909 | $460 | $1,460 |
| McCallsburg 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,025 | $615 | $1,735 |
| McCallsburg 3 Bedroom Apartments | $850 | $465 | $2,300 |
| McCallsburg 4 Bedroom Apartments | $581 | $445 | $910 |

Largest Available McCallsburg and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in McCallsburg, IA is found at Brick Towne Ames in the South Ames neighborhood and is 1,804 square feet priced from $2,200. The Grove in the Grand Junction neighborhood has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,390 square feet and currently listed start at $549. Here is today’s list of the largest available 3 Bedroom units in McCallsburg: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Brick Towne Ames | 3 Bedroom TH | 1,804 Sq Ft | $2,200 |
| The Grove | 3BR/3BA - Deluxe | 1,390 Sq Ft | $549 |
| The Landing Ames | C1 - 3x3 | 1,342 Sq Ft | $535 |
| Campustown | 200 Stanton Ave - 3 Bed - 1 Bath - C - UF | 1,298 Sq Ft | $489 |
| Prairie West | 3 Bedroom Townhome (Renovated) | 1,280 Sq Ft | $1,595 |
| Crystal Street Apartments | 3BR/2.0BA | 1,137 Sq Ft | $1,075 |
| Hyland Apartments | 3 Bedroom Apartment | 1,118 Sq Ft | $1,500 |
| Copper Beech | 3BR/3BA | 613 Sq Ft | $660 |
Cheapest Available McCallsburg and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
As of July 09, 2026 the lowest priced 3 Bedroom apartment unit in McCallsburg, IA is the 200 Stanton Ave - 3 Bed - 1 Bath - C - UF Model starting from $489 at Campustown in the Somerset neighborhood. The second most affordable McCallsburg 3 Bedroom is the 3BR/3BA Upgraded Model at The Grove starting at $599 in the Grand Junction neighborhood. The average price for all 3 Bedroom apartments in McCallsburg is currently $850.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 3 Bedroom options in McCallsburg: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| Campustown | 200 Stanton Ave - 3 Bed - 1 Bath - C - UF | $489 |
| The Grove | 3BR/3BA Upgraded | $599 |
| Copper Beech | 3BR/3BA | $660 |
| Crystal Street Apartments | 3BR/2.0BA | $1,075 |
| Hyland Apartments | 3 Bedroom Apartment | $1,500 |
| Prairie West | 3 Bedroom Townhome (Renovated) | $1,595 |
| Brick Towne Ames | 3 Bedroom TH | $2,200 |
